If you find such a system be certain to alert the world.

What you aret alking about is called a human being.  One that can look at the
section at incremental grinds and determine where they are in relation to what
is needed.

All automated systems go to a preset location and you get what is at
that preset location.  Hence the need to have an alignment system to put
what you want at the right location.
